Frequently asked questions
Do I need a specialized cleaner or is soap enough?
Regular hand soap and body wash can degrade certain toy materials over time, particularly porous materials like TPE or cyberskin. Dedicated toy cleaners use pH-balanced formulas designed to clean without breaking down silicone, rubber, or specialized coatings. Antibacterial dish soap works in a pinch for non-porous toys like glass or stainless steel, but specialized cleaners offer material-safe antimicrobial action and typically rinse more completely without leaving soap residue that can cause irritation during next use.

Can toy cleaners damage silicone or other materials?
Quality toy cleaners are formulated to be safe for all common toy materials when used as directed. The cleaners ranked here are all explicitly compatible with silicone, glass, metal, ABS plastic, and TPE. Avoid cleaners containing alcohol concentrations above 5%, silicone oils, or petroleum-based ingredients, as these can degrade certain materials over time. The contact time specified on the product label matters - leaving cleaner on porous materials beyond recommended duration can cause surface breakdown even with safe formulas.
Should I use spray or foam cleaners?
Foam cleaners like our top two picks deliver pre-measured doses that cling to vertical surfaces, making them efficient for thorough cleaning with minimal product waste. Spray cleaners excel for quick spot-cleaning, travel scenarios, and reaching crevices in textured toys where foam might not penetrate. If you primarily clean smooth silicone toys at home, foam offers better value per use. For textured toys, travel, or quick refreshing between storage periods, spray formats provide more practical application despite slightly higher product consumption per session.

Do these cleaners actually extend toy lifespan?
Proper cleaning removes oils, lubricants, and biological material that can degrade toy surfaces over time, particularly on porous materials like TPE or realistic-skin textures. Verified buyer reports consistently show toys cleaned with dedicated formulas maintain surface integrity and flexibility longer than toys cleaned with improvised methods or left uncleaned. Silicone and glass toys are less vulnerable to cleaning-method degradation but still benefit from antimicrobial action that prevents bacterial buildup in microscopic surface imperfections. The longevity benefit is most measurable on porous materials and toys with motors or electronic components where moisture exposure from improper cleaning causes early failure.
Can I use toy cleaner immediately before use instead of after?
Some formulas like the Lovehoney Fresh are explicitly condom-compatible and safe for immediate pre-use application, making them practical for quick refreshing of stored toys. Most cleaners are designed for post-use cleaning with a rinse-and-dry protocol before storage. If you want to use cleaner immediately before use, verify the product label confirms it's safe for internal contact and requires no rinse, or plan for a quick water rinse and complete dry before use. Pre-use cleaning is most relevant for toys removed from storage after extended periods, while post-use cleaning is the primary hygiene protocol for active rotation.
